Kolkata, June 29 -- Signs of political turbulence have now reached the panchayat level after developments in municipal bodies, with six TMC Panchayat chiefs in Bongaon submitting their resignation letters together in what is being described as a mass resignation.

The resignation letters were submitted to the Block Development Officer (BDO) on Monday. Those who stepped down include the chiefs of Chhoygharia, Ganganandapur, Akaipur, Gopalpur I, Gopalpur II and Dharmapukuria Gram Panchayats.

One of the outgoing panchayat chiefs, Sabita Sarkar, said the resignations were submitted due to personal reasons. "All of us have resigned for personal reasons. At this moment, I do not wish to say anything more," she said.

According to sources, the reasons mentioned in the resignation letters vary. While some cited personal grounds, others stated that it had become difficult to continue functioning under the changed circumstances.

Reacting to the development, Bongaon BJP organisational district president Bikash Ghosh alleged that all those who resigned had been involved in corruption. He claimed that after the BJP came to power and investigations began, they stepped down out of fear.
